创意编程与开发是什么工作
-
创意编程与开发是一个涉及创意和技术的工作领域。它结合了计算机编程和创意思维,旨在通过编写代码和应用创意概念来创建新颖、有趣和有创意的程序和应用。
创意编程与开发可以应用于多个领域,如游戏开发、网站设计、艺术创作、交互设计等。它不仅要求具备计算机编程知识和技能,还需要有艺术和创意思维的能力。
在创意编程与开发领域工作的人通常具备以下技能和能力:编程语言的掌握,如Java、Python、C++等;计算机图形学和算法的基础知识;艺术和设计的基本概念和技能;对创造独特和有创意的用户体验有深刻理解;对创意和设计过程有敏锐的洞察力;团队合作和沟通能力等。
创意编程与开发的工作流程可以包括以下几个步骤:
-
理解需求:与客户或团队成员沟通,了解项目的目标和需求,明确项目的创意和技术要求。
-
创意思考:为了打造有趣和有创意的程序和应用,创意思考是非常重要的一步。这可以包括头脑风暴、设计草图和概念开发等。
-
编码和开发:根据项目需求和创意概念,使用合适的编程语言和工具开始编写代码,创建程序和应用。这包括软件开发、游戏设计、网站构建等。
-
测试和调试:在编码和开发完成后,进行测试和调试,确保程序和应用的功能正常运行,并解决可能出现的问题和错误。
-
发布和推广:一旦测试和调试完成,程序和应用可以发布和推广给目标用户。这可以包括发布到应用商店、网站上传等,同时进行推广和市场营销活动,吸引用户使用和体验。
创意编程与开发工作的责任是开发和创造出有趣和有创意的程序和应用,为用户带来新颖和独特的体验。它结合了技术和艺术,需要创造力和创新精神。
1年前 -
-
创意编程与开发是一种结合创意思维和编程技术的工作,旨在创造卓越的数字产品和服务。以下是关于创意编程与开发的五个关键要点:
-
结合创意思维和编程技术:创意编程与开发将创意思维与编程技术相结合,以创造独特、创新的数字产品和服务。这种工作要求开发人员具备创造能力和技术实践能力,能够将想法转化为实际可行的解决方案。
-
动手创造数字产品:创意编程与开发的主要目标是创造数字产品和服务,例如移动应用程序、网站、虚拟现实体验等。通过使用各种编程语言和开发工具,开发人员可以构建具有丰富功能和独特体验的数字产品。
-
与设计团队合作:在创意编程与开发中,开发人员通常需要与设计团队合作。设计团队负责提供创意和用户体验方面的指导,而开发人员负责将这些创意转化为可操作的代码。这种合作是创意编程与开发成功的关键。
-
不断学习和创新:创意编程与开发是一个不断发展和演变的领域,要求开发人员不断学习和创新。技术的快速进步意味着开发人员需要不断学习新的编程语言和工具,并跟上技术的最新趋势和发展。
-
解决问题和调试:创意编程与开发并不总是一帆风顺。开发人员经常面临各种问题和挑战,需要具备解决问题和调试技巧。这包括识别和修复错误、优化性能以及处理各种技术难题。
总而言之,创意编程与开发是一项综合技能的工作,要求开发人员具备创意思维和编程技术,能够创造出卓越的数字产品和服务。这种工作需要与设计团队合作,并面临各种挑战和解决问题的能力。同时,开发人员需要持续学习和创新,以跟上技术的发展。
1年前 -
-
创意编程与开发是一种结合创新思维和编程技术的工作。它的目标是将创意转化为实际可行的应用程序、软件或者游戏,并通过编程实现创意的具体功能和交互。
创意编程与开发既涉及到创作思维和设计过程,也需要熟悉各种编程语言和工具。这项工作的核心是将创意和技术结合起来,通过编程来实现创意的表达和呈现。
下面将从方法、操作流程等方面解释创意编程与开发的工作内容。
1. 创意的提炼与规划
创意编程与开发的首要任务是将创意进行提炼和规划。这个阶段需要与创意的提出者进行深入的交流和沟通,了解他们的意图和期望。通过讨论和分析,将创意转化为具体的需求和功能要求。同时,还需要考虑创意是否可行,是否存在技术实现的难点和挑战。在这个阶段,创意编程员需要具备良好的判断力和沟通能力,能够与客户就创意的价值和可行性进行有效的沟通和协商。
2. 编程语言和工具的选择
根据创意的具体需求和要求,创意编程与开发需要选择合适的编程语言和工具来实现创意的功能。不同的创意可能需要使用不同的编程语言和工具。比如,开发一个手机应用程序可能需要使用Java或者Swift等编程语言;开发一个网页游戏可能需要使用HTML5、CSS和JavaScript等技术。创意编程员需要深入了解不同的编程语言和工具,并能够根据具体的需求进行选择和应用。
3. 编码实现和调试
在选择了合适的编程语言和工具之后,创意编程与开发需要进行具体的编码实现和调试工作。这个过程需要熟练掌握所选编程语言的语法和特性,并能够将需求转化为具体的代码逻辑和算法。编码实现的过程中,可能会遇到各种各样的问题和bug,需要进行调试和修复。创意编程员需要具备良好的问题解决能力和调试技巧,能够快速定位和解决问题。
4. 创意表达和交互设计
创意编程与开发不仅仅是实现功能,还需要考虑创意的表达和交互设计。创意的表现形式可以是各种应用程序、软件、游戏等,创意编程员需要通过界面设计、动画效果等方式来表达创意的主题和情感。同时,还需要设计用户与创意的交互方式,确保用户能够方便地使用和互动。这个过程需要具备艺术和设计的能力,能够创意编程员可以通过学习美术、设计和交互设计等相关知识来提升自己。
5. 测试和优化
在创意编程与开发的过程中,测试和优化是一个非常重要的环节。创意编程员需要进行各种测试,确保应用程序的各项功能能够正常运行。同时,还需要对应用程序进行优化,提高其性能和用户体验。创意编程员可以通过调整代码结构、改善算法等方式来进行优化。在优化过程中,需要关注应用程序的运行效率、资源占用和响应速度等方面。
总结一下,创意编程与开发是一项涉及到创作思维、编程技术和设计能力的工作。它的核心是将创意转化为实际可行的应用程序、软件或者游戏,并通过编程实现创意的具体功能和交互。创意编程与开发的工作流程包括创意的提炼与规划、编程语言和工具的选择、编码实现和调试、创意表达和交互设计、测试和优化等环节。创意编程员需要具备创新思维、编程技术和设计能力,能够将创意转化为实际的代码和应用。
1年前